You'll need a cat flap installer if you want to install a pet door in your upvc cat flap door panels or glass panel. They can also help you with more sophisticated models such as microchip pet flaps.

DIY attempts to install a pet flap can often cause issues like draughts and low energy efficiency. A professional tradesperson can spare you the hassle and expense of dealing with these problems.

Types

There are many cat flaps on the market starting from basic manual flaps to sophisticated microchips and apps-controlled systems. The type of cat flap you choose will depend on your pet's requirements and the features that are most important to you. A professional can assist you in selecting the most appropriate pet flap for your home and pets.

It is also important to ensure that the flap you select is appropriately for your cat. A cat flap that is too small could cause discomfort, or even impossible for your pet to use. A professional can assist you determine the right size for your pet's door, taking into account their size, weight, and temperament.

Another factor to consider is the step over height of the pet back door with cat flap fitted. It is recommended that the height of the step-over be no more than 1/3rd of your pet's height to stop them from ramming through and potentially hurting themselves. This is especially crucial if you own an extremely large or aggressive pet.

If you don't wish to have an entirely new door, a Tasker will assist you in installing a cat flap inside your door. This can be a much affordable alternative to replacing the entire door, and will still allow your pets the freedom they require to move around their space.

To install an animal flap on an unglazed panel, you'll need mark the desired area on the panel and then drill four holes. Once you've done this then you can cut the shape using the jigsaw. Once the flap is cut, you'll need to sand the edges and apply caulk. Then, you can mount the flap onto the wall and screw it into place.

There are many different types of cat flaps available. Each type comes with its own advantages and features. There are manual flaps that are standard, microchip-activated flaps that recognise your cat's unique microchip and magnetic key flaps that respond to a magnetic ring on your cat's collar. There are also cat flaps with remote control that can be operated with a mobile app that gives you additional security and control over your pet's access.

A standard cat flap is a basic choice that offers a minimum amount of security. If you're worried about the safety of your cat flap fitters near me then a cat flap that is lockable may be better for you. It lets you close the flap when required, like at night or while you're on vacation.

Generally, it's recommended to avoid installing an animal flap on the main entrance door to your home, since this could reduce the security of your home. The reason is that burglars are able to access the hole in your door and unlock it or break into your house. You can limit this risk by installing the cat flap on a wall far from your door, or by selecting the lockable model.

It is recommended to discuss your security options with a specialist, who will be able to help you choose the right cat flap for your needs and suggest alternatives that will provide greater security.
